You can change the programming of your cooktop (see
chart). You can change several settings one after the other.
After starting the programming function P (Program), an S
(Status) will appear in the timer display. With cooktops that
have 3 cooking zones, an additional display appears at the
back left.
The program is displayed in the front left and back left
settings bars. Example:
Program
3 = front left 3, back left 0
Program 14 = front left 4, back left 1
The status is displayed in the front right settings bar.
When programming is completed, a reset is carried out
automatically. This is completed when the indicator above the
s sensor comes on briefly.
Do not switch the cooktop on again until reset is
completed.
^ With the cooktop switched off, touch the s and $ sensors
at the same time until the Lock indicator flashes.
^ To set the ones, touch the respective number on the front
left settings bar.
^ To set the tens, touch the respective number on the back
left settings bar.
^ Touch the respective number on the front right settings
bar.
^ Touch the s sensor until the displays go out.
^ Touch the $ sensor until the displays go out.
